This book explores microbial lifestyles, biochemical adaptations,
and trophic interactions occurring in extreme environments. By
summarizing the latest findings in the field it provides a valuable
reference for future studies. Spark ideas for biotechnological and
commercial exploitation of microbiomes at the extremes of life are
presented. Chapters on viruses complement this highly informative
book. In a vertical journey through the microbial biosphere it
covers aspects of cold environments, hot environments, extreme
saline environments, and extreme pressure environments, and more.
From the deep sea, through polar deserts, up to the clouds in the
air - the diversity of microbial life in all habitats is described,
explored, and comprehensively reviewed. Possible biotechnical
applications are discussed. This book aims to provide a useful
reference for those who want to start a research program in extreme
microbiology and, hopefully, inspire new research directions.

Dr.Telmesani, a Harvard and UC Berkeley graduate, was a university
professor, a highly successful manager, and honored board member
who, in 1995, came to the realization that his happiness and peace
of mind were directly linked to incidents that occurred at work and
with his family. He also realized that many of these incidents were
out of his control, thereby making these states of contentment
dependent on volatile factors. Did that mean that if unpleasant
events occurred, he had to give up his happiness or peace of mind?
And how could he remain in a positive state even when efforts to
achieve success don't go as planned? From these thoughts came the
compelling and insightful book, The Balanced Way. From balancing a
formula of excellence and contentment to having a balanced
perception of reality, from improving our expectations of the
future to freeing ourselves from past experiences, while
maintaining ethical standards and a true passion for growth, this
book delivers at every level.
